Salary of Business & Commerce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$48,618 Bachelor's Median Salary

Business & Commerce maj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Coker go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$48,618 a year. This is higher than $40,999, the median for all majors at Coker.

Student Debt of Business & Commerce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$27,000 Bachelor's Median Debt

Earning a bachelor’s degree at Coker, business & commerce graduates take on a median debt of $27,000 in student loans. This is lower than $29,362, the typical median for all majors at Coker.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 39% of business & commerce bachelor’s degrees went to men and 61% went to women.

Coker gender breakdown of Business & Commerce Bachelor's degree grads The majority of business & commerce bachelor’s degree graduates at Coker were White. About 78% of graduates fell into this category.
